SolarNet to provide worldwide travel agent distribution to European travel

Matel Data Systems<.>, a London based developer of database application software for the European and UK travel industry, and SolarNet<.>, a leading provider of business-to-business information management and electronic distribution solutions for the travel industry, announced the signing of reseller agreement whereby Matel will resell SolarNet's multi-GDS (Global Distribution System) distribution to its European and United Kingdom travel vendor clients.



Matel specializes in the consolidator segment of the travel industry providing inventory management and reservation systems. Matel's products include: Faresbureau –for air consolidators; Carsbureau –for car rental consolidators; and the soon to be released Hotelsbureau — for hotel room consolidators. Prior to selecting SolarNet, Matel has offered their clients Internet based distribution solutions only.



Under the agreement, Matel will develop the application protocol interfaces (APIs) that will link Faresbureau, Carsbureau and Hotelsbureau to SolarNet enabling approximately 450,000 travel agents worldwide to access Matel's client inventories via SolarNet's direct connections to the major GDS networks.



Faresbureau: Used by air consolidators in the UK and Europe, Faresbureau currently offers Internet distribution only. The addition of SolarNet will give Faresbureau clients a multi-GDS presence with global travel agent distribution and transaction capabilities.



Carsbureau: Launched in partnership with a European car rental consolidator, Carsbureau offers worldwide car rentals through the free-sale arrangements they have with numerous car rental companies. Carsbureau currently offers Internet distribution only, and with SolarNet, Carsbureau clients will have a multi-GDS presence with global travel agent distribution and transaction capabilities.



Hotelsbureau: A new Matel venture to be launched later this quarter, automates the inventory management and reservation process for hotel room consolidators. Hotelsbureau will launch offering clients both Internet distribution, and SolarNet's global multi-GDS presence with travel agent distribution and transaction capabilities.



Matel will charge its clients a service fee on every travel agent transaction generated through SolarNet, and Solarnet will receive a percentage of all service fees. Based on Matel's API development schedule, SolarNet expects to realize initial revenue from this agreement in May of this year.
